Wim Hof Method Breathing Exercises

The Wim Hof Method is a combination of breathing exercises, cold exposure, and meditation techniques developed by Wim Hof, also known as “The Iceman.” The method has gained popularity in recent years due to its potential physical and mental health benefits. Here are some of the benefits associated with the Wim Hof Method breathing exercises:

  1. Stress reduction: The controlled breathing exercises in the Wim Hof Method can help activate the parasympathetic nervous system, leading to a relaxation response that reduces stress and anxiety.
  2. Improved focus and mental clarity: Practicing the Wim Hof breathing exercises can increase blood flow and oxygen levels in the brain, which may lead to enhanced mental clarity, focus, and cognitive function.
  3. Increased energy: The breathing exercises can help improve oxygen delivery to your cells, boosting energy production and potentially increasing overall energy levels.
  4. Enhanced immune system: Some studies suggest that the Wim Hof Method may help strengthen the immune system by increasing the production of white blood cells and reducing inflammation.
  5. Better sleep: The relaxation response from the breathing exercises can help calm the mind and body, which may lead to improved sleep quality.
  6. Improved endurance and athletic performance: The increased oxygen delivery to the muscles through the breathing exercises may lead to enhanced athletic performance and endurance, allowing for better recovery and reduced muscle fatigue.
  7. Emotional well-being: The combination of deep breathing and meditation techniques in the Wim Hof Method can help improve emotional regulation and resilience, leading to a greater sense of well-being and happiness.
  8. Cold tolerance: The Wim Hof Method aims to improve cold tolerance through a combination of breathing exercises and gradual exposure to cold temperatures. This can help the body adapt to cold environments more efficiently and potentially increase cold resistance.

It’s important to note that while many people have reported positive results from practicing the Wim Hof Method, scientific research on its benefits is still limited. If you’re interested in trying the Wim Hof Method, consult with a healthcare professional to ensure it’s appropriate for your individual circumstances, and follow the guidelines provided by Wim Hof or a certified instructor. Always practice the breathing exercises in a safe environment and avoid doing them while driving, swimming, or in any situation where losing consciousness could be dangerous.
